Summary
Securonix provides the Next Generation Security and Information Event Management (SIEM) solution. As a recognized leader in the SIEM industry, Securonix helps some of largest organizations globally to detect sophisticated cyberattacks and rapidly respond to these attacks within minutes. With the Securonix SNYPR platform, organizations can collect billions of events each day and analyze them in near real time to detect advanced persistent threats (APTs), insider threats, privilege account misuses and online fraud.
Securonix pioneered the User and Entity Behavior Analytics (UEBA) market and holds patents in the use of behavioral algorithms to detect malicious activities. The Securonix SNYPR platform is built on big data Hadoop technologies and is infinitely scalable. Our platform is used by some of the largest organizations in the financial, healthcare, pharmaceutical, manufacturing, and federal sectors.
